Transaction f656573c895484fc54e03b8fdd4d1bf0058205f1e9fe3df544e174faf08348b9
1 Input
1 Output
-
f656573c895484fc54e03b8fdd4d1bf0058205f1e9fe3df544e174faf08348b9:0
- value
- 290000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2318426f505ec90435299ec80bf2835b9d2b0825 OP_EQUAL
- address
- 34tadqZwPGGW38CVz34epK9jYTwn78ty8W